In the wake of the 18th century conflicts that followed the Battle of Bobbili in 1757, the land of South India finds itself roiled by political chaos and the encroaching influence of distant powers. At the heart of this turmoil lies a legendary treasure of the Amaraveedu dynasty, hidden away in a cave behind five sturdy doors and secured by five keys. To keep the wealth from falling into the hands of the British, two steadfast friends, Daanaala Dharmayya and Pagadaala Subbayya, split the keys and scatter the treasure far and wide. Dharmayya flees to Kurnool, while Subbayya seeks refuge in Gadwal, each guarding a different piece of the puzzle to ensure the riches stay out of reach.

Enter Krishna Prasad, a reform-minded social advocate who raises his voice for the poor as the town’s new government asserts itself. When a notorious highway robber, Nakkajittula Naaganna, is captured and offered a hefty reward, Krishna sees an opportunity not just to profit but to assist the needy. He captures Naaganna, binds him with ropes, and hands him over for the bounty. Yet in a quiet twist of conscience, Krishna secretly frees the robber and shares the loot, using the money to uplift the marginalized. This cunning move earns him broad support from the people and a growing reputation as someone who stands for justice—even if his methods are unorthodox.

A pivotal turn comes when a blind old man, once a servant of the Amaraveedu court, unwittingly reveals the treasure’s keys to a tavern crowd. The information leaks to Sathyam, a rival with designs on the fortune. Sathyam tortures the blind man to extract more details, learns that Dharmayya is in Kurnool, and acts with ruthless haste, killing Dharmayya on the road. Radha, Dharmayya’s daughter, arrives to witness her father’s dying moments. Misled into believing that Subbayya is responsible for the murder, she vows revenge and sets out on a path of vengeance that will entangle many lives.

On his deathbed, Subbayya confides in his son, revealing the treasure’s location and noting that a crucial key had already passed through the hands of Komarayya, a retired constable in Kurnool. Meanwhile, Krishna Prasad keeps adding to his earnings through schemes tied to Naaganna, but his attention also turns to love. He falls for Radha and decides to train her as a sharpshooter to help her seek retribution. Radha’s pledge to avenge her father’s death becomes a guiding force, shaping her every move.

Radha’s pursuit of vengeance brings her into conflict with Bijili, a rival cowgirl who is not immune to the charms of Krishna. Naaganna, still smarting from old grievances, seizes an opportunity to steal Krishna’s loot and is left stranded in the desert after a brutal punishment. Consumed by spite, Naaganna teams up with Bijili to torment Krishna. In a brutal desert showdown, Naaganna and Bijili capture and torture Krishna. They uncover a cart of corpses—among them the son of Pagadaala Subbayya—who, in his last breath, discloses a crucial detail about the treasure.

Greed drives Naaganna to impersonate Pagadaala Subbayya, a ruse that helps Krishna recover from his injuries. The two escape together, while Naaganna, now in Subbayya’s disguise, is eventually captured by Sathyam’s gang. Krishna rescues him, and Naaganna reopens his alliance with Krishna in a fight against those who would claim the treasure for themselves. Radha then reveals that her father once worked for Komarayya, the man who had received one of the keys, hinting at old loyalties that still influence new choices.

The trio—Krishna Prasad, Radha, and Naaganna—press on toward the legendary cave. A violent clash erupts as rival robbers converge, each seeking the five sacks of wealth. After a fierce battle, Krishna and Radha triumph and stand before the treasure: five sacks of gold and wealth, the culmination of their arduous journey. In a moment of justice earned through courage, cooperation, and sacrifice, Krishna and Radha share the treasure, restoring a measure of balance and sowing the seeds for a future where the poor might finally reap the rewards of their labor.
